Transaction 51c7c5849d5752c12ecd90eda36e67fbf1afa516a282481119da0bf7e732be08

1 Input
2 Outputs
  • 51c7c5849d5752c12ecd90eda36e67fbf1afa516a282481119da0bf7e732be08:0
  • value  390000
    address  3B5rPQ7VMygce1E1wzdR5aD4SYphYZmo3s
  • 51c7c5849d5752c12ecd90eda36e67fbf1afa516a282481119da0bf7e732be08:1
  • value  7561727
    address  3ECVpn9uh9YaEaqMsQgrMjQShwZ6WcNStX